  • In this video I'll be showing you how to make very simple 3D duplicates using the Creality CR Scan Ferret. This scanner is very simple to use and creates near perfect scans and replicas. You are able to scan small or large objects, people, faces and much more. It is compatible with an Android phone for on the go, however, it currently does not support iPhone. This does scan the object at full size but you can easily scale down the object to suit your needs. I tested this creality scanner on a statue I had and then 3D printed the model on my 3D printer.       Blender is fairly easy and it’s free. Download it, import the .stl and go into sculpt mode. You can click on the smooth brush on the left to smooth things out. There’s a ton of other brushes as well to help with sculpting. I’d recommend just watching a beginner tutorial on how to navigate everything and the controls but it’s really not the hard especially for simple things. Keep in mind though that you may have to remesh the model if you have a low number of polygons to begin with. In this video the model was already pretty high so that was unnecessary.
